| 1 | Clearing grass and removal of rubbish up to a distance of 30 m outside the periphery of the area as per Technical Specification Clause 201. |
| 2 | Excavation for roadwork in soil with hydraulic excavator of 0.9 cum bucket capacity including cutting and loading in tippers, trimming bottom and side slopes, in accordance with requirements of lines, grades and cross sections, and transporting to the embankment location within all lifts and lead upto 1000m (including Royalty @ Rs. 30.00 per Cum but excluding watering, rolling & compaction) |
| 3 | Construction of embankment with approved materials deposited at site from roadway cutting and excavation from drain and foundation of other structures graded and compacted to meet requirement of table 300-2. |
| 4 | Construction of subgrade and earthen shoulders with approved material obtained from borrow pits with all lifts and leads, transporting to site, spreading, grading to required slope and compacted to meet requirement of Table 300.2 with free lead as per Technical Specification Clause 303.1. |
| 5 | By Mix in Place Method Construction of granular sub-base by providing close graded material, spreading in uniform layers with motor grader on prepared surface, mixing by mix in place method with front end loader at OMC, and compacting with vibratory roller to achieve the desired density, complete as per clause 401. Rate per cum for grading-IMaterial |
| 6 | Construction of dry lean cement concrete Sub- base over a prepared sub-grade with coarse and fine aggregate conforming to IS: 383, the size of coarse aggregate not exceeding 25 mm, aggregate cement ratio not to exceed 15:1, aggregate gradation after blending to be as per table 600-1, cement content not to be less than 150 kg/ cum, optimum moisture content to be determined during trial length construction, concrete strength not to be less than 10 Mpa at 7 days, mixed in a batching plant, transported to site, laid with a paver with electronic sensor, compacting with 8-10 tonnes vibratory roller, finishing and curing. |
| 7 | Wet Mix Macadam (Plant Mix Method) Providing, laying, spreading and compacting graded stone aggregate to wet mix macadam specification including premixing the Material with water at OMC in mechanical mix plant carriage of mixed Material by tipper to site, laying in uniform layers with grader in sub- base / base course on well prepared surface and compacting with vibratory roller to achieve the desired density. |
| 8 | Prime Coat over WMM/WBM Providing and applying primer coat with SS1 grade bitumen emulsion on prepared surface of granular Base including clearing of road surface and spraying primer at the rate of 0.70 kg/sqm using mechanical means. With Emulsion SS1 IS8887 (HDPE) |
| 9 | Providing and applying tack coat with bitumen emulsion (RS-1) using emulsion distributor at the rate of 0.20 to 0.25 kg per sqm on the prepared bituminous surface treated with primer & cleaned with Hydraulic broom as per Tecnical Specification Clause 503 |
| 10 | Bituminous Macadam Grading-II with VG-30 Grade Packed Bitumen Providing and laying bituminous macadam with higher capacity hot mix plant using crushed aggregates of specified grading premixed with bituminous binder, transported to site, laid over a previously prepared surface with paver finisher to the required grade, level and alignment and rolled as per clauses 501.6 and 501.7 to achieve the desired compaction. |
| 11 | Semi-Dense Bituminous Concrete Providing and laying semi dense bituminous concrete with 100-120 TPH batch type HMP producing an average output of 75 tonnes per hour using crushed aggregates of specified grading, premixed with bituminous binder @ 4.5 to 5per centof mix and filler, transporting the hot mix to work site, laying with a hydrostatic paver finisher with sensor control to the required grade, level and alignment, rolling with smooth wheeled, vibratory and tandem rollers to achieve the desired compaction as per MoRTH specification clause No. 508 complete in all respects.for GradingII(10 mm nominal size) |
| 12 | Construction ofun-reinforced, dowel jointed at expansion and construction joint only, plain cement concrete pavement, thickness as per design, over a prepared sub base, with 43 grade cement or any other type as per Clause 1501.2.2 M30 (Grade), coarse and fine aggregates conforming to IS:383, maximum size of coarse aggregate not exceeding 25 mm, mixed in a concrete mixer of not less than 0.2 cum capacity and appropriate weigh batcher using approved mix design,laid in approved fixed side formwork (steel channel, laying and fixing of 125 micron thick polythene film, wedges, steel plates including levelling the formwork as per drawing), spreading the concrete with shovels, rakes, compacted using needle, screed and plate vibrators and finished in continuous operation including provision of contraction and expansion, construction joints, applying debonding strips, primer, sealant, dowel bars, near approaches to bridge/culvert and construction joints, admixtures as approved, curing of concrete slabs for 14-days using curing compound (where specified) and water finishing to lines and grade as per drawingand Technical Specification Clause 1501 |
| 13 | Reinforced cement concrete M15grade Ordinary kilometre stone (precast) stone/local stone of standard design as per IRC:8 fixing in position including painting and printing, etc as per drawing and Technical Specification Clause 1703. |
| 14 | Reinforced cement concrete M15grade 200 m Post stone (precast) stone/local stone of standard design as per IRC:8 fixing in position including painting and printing, etc as per drawing and Technical Specification Clause 1703. |
| 15 | Reinforced cement concrete M15 grade FI Post of standard design as per IRC:8-1980, fixing in position including painting and printing etc. FI post |
| 16 | Providing and fixing of retro- reflectorised cautionary, mandatory and informatory sign as per IRC :67 made of high intensity grade sheeting vide clause 801.3, fixed over aluminium sheeting, 1.5 mm thick supported on a mild steel angle iron post 75 mm x 75 mm x 6 mm firmly fixed to the ground by means of properly designed foundation with M15 grade cement concrete 45 cm x 45 cm x 60 cm, 60 cm below ground level as per approved drawing |
| 17 | Providing and erecting direction and place identification retro-reflectorised sign as per IRC:67 made of high intensity grade sheeting vide clause 801.3, fixed over aluminium sheeting, 2 mm thick with area not exceeding 0.9 sqm supported on a mild steel single angle iron post 75 x 75 x 6 mm firmly fixed to the ground by means of properly designed foundation with M15 grade cement concrete 45 x 45 x 60 cm, 60 cm below ground level as per approved drawing |
| 18 | Road Marking with Hot Applied Thermoplastic Compound with Reflectorising Glass Beads on Bituminous Surface (Providing and laying of hot applied thermoplastic compound 2.5 mm thick including reflectorising glass beads @ 250 gms per sqm area, thickness of 2.5 mm is exclusive of surface applied glass beads as per IRC:35 .The finished surface to be level, uniform and free from streaks and holes.) |
| 19 | E/W in excavation for structure as per drawing and technical specification clause 305.1 including setting out, construction of shoring and brading, removal of stumps and other deleterious material and disposal utp a lead of 50m, dressing of sides and bottom backfilling in trenches with excavated suitable material. (with manual means in ordinary soil & Depth upto 3m) |
| 20 | Providing concrete for plain/reinforced concrete in open foundations complete as per drawings and technical specifications Clause 802, 803, 1202 & 1203 (P.C.C. Grade M-15 in Open Foundation) |
| 21 | Stone masonry work in cement mortar in foundation complete as per drawing and technical specifications Clauses 702, 704, 1202 & 1203. Random Rubble Masonary in C.M. 1:3 in foundation in Drain & in Retaining Wall |
| 22 | Stone masonry work in cement mortar in sub-structure complete as per drawing and technical specifications Clauses 702, 704, 1202 & 1203. Random Rubble Masonary in C.M. 1:3 in Retaining Wall |
| 23 | Stone masonry work in cement mortar in foundation complete as per drawing and technical specifications Clauses 702, 704, 1202 & 1203. Coarse Rubble Masonry Work in CM 1:3 in foundation in Culverts |
| 24 | Stone masonry work in cement mortar in sub-structure complete as per drawing and technical specifications Clauses 702, 704, 1202 & 1203. Coarse Rubble Masonry Work in Cement Mortar 1:3 in Culverts |
| 25 | Plain/reinforced cement concrete in substructure complete as per drawings and technical specification Clauses 802, 804, 805, 806, 807, 1202 ans 1204. (P.C.C. Grade M-15 in Coping) |
| 26 | Plain/reinforced cement concrete in substructure complete as per drawings and technical specification Clauses 802, 804, 805, 806, 807, 1202 ans 1204 (P.C.C. Grade M-20) |
| 27 | Providing and laying reinforced cement concrete in superstructure as per drawing and technical specifications Clauses 800, 1205.4 and 1205.5 (P.C.C. Grade M-25 in Deck Slab) |
| 28 | Providing and laying cement concrete wearing course M 30 grade including reinforcement complete as per drawing and technical specifications Clauses 800 and 1206.3 |
| 29 | Supplying, fitting and placing TMT bar reinforcement (Fe 415) in substructrue complete as per drawings and technical specification Clauses 1002, 1005, 1010 & 1202 |
| 30 | Plastering with cement mortar (1:3) 15 mm thick on brickwork in parapet as per technical specifications Clauses 613.4 and 1208.4 |
| 31 | Providing and laying of dry rubble flooring complete as per drawings and technical specifications Clause 1303.3 |
| 32 | Backfilling behind abutment, wing wall and return wall complete as per drawings & technical specification Clause 1204.3.8(With Sandy Material) |
| 33 | Providing weepholes in brick masonry/stone masonry, plain/reinforced concrete abutment, wing wall, return wall with 100 mm dia AC pipe extending through the full width of the structures with slope of 1(V):20(H) towards drawing face complete as per drawing and technical specification Clauses 614, 709, 1204.3.7 |
| 34 | Pointing with cement mortar (1:3 ) on brick work in substructure as per Technical Specifications |
